A meeting of the Disabled Persons Advisory Board of the Township of Lower Makefield was held in the Municipal Building on Tuesday, July 27, 2004. Chairman Rogers opened the meeting at 7:35 p.m.

Mr. Fegley said
that he is a member of the BCCID. He
said the Council is having an awards dinner on October 28th and he
invited the Board members to attend the dinner.
Mr. Fegley
stated that the state has given a $250,000 grant to build a Center for
Independent Living in Bucks County. He
stated that the money would be given to the BCCID to build the Independent
Center. Mr. Fegley said that when the
money is received, there will be a lot of spin-off work for this Board such as
where should the Independent Center be located and what will it include. The Board discussed the possible roles the
Independent Center could provide.
Mr. Rogers asked
Mr. Fegley if the Board should make a motion stating the Board’s full support
of the state grant to build a Center for Independent Living in Bucks
County. Ms. Harbison moved, Mr. Rogers
seconded and it was unanimously carried to write a letter of support for the
state grant to build a Center for Independent Living.
Mr. Rogers asked
whom the letter should be sent to. Ms.
Harbison said she would be meeting with Ms. Liberti the next day and would ask
her about the details of where to send the letter of support.

Mr. Rogers said
that he spoke with Mr. Fedorchak regarding the request from the Bexley Orchards
Homeowners Association to the Township to alter the traffic signal on Big Oak
Road to accommodate a blind woman living in their development who walks to the
nearby shopping center. Mr. Fedorchak
said that he spoke with the Township engineers who would provide the Township
with a price to alter the light to accommodate a disabled person. Mr. Fegley suggested if Mr. Rogers does not
hear from Mr. Fedorchak, that he request to be placed on the next Board of
Supervisors meeting agenda.
Mr. Rogers said
that he and Mr. McConville looked at the Memorial Park Plans and sent a memo to
Nancy Frick and Terry Fedorchak with their comments to the plans. Mr. Rogers said he is concerned that because
this board is not on a formal list to review plans, plans that should be
reviewed will be overlooked. Mr. Fegley
suggested that Mr. Rogers first ask Ms. Frick to include the Board on the list
to review plans and if she objects, then Mr. Fegley suggested the Board ask to
be placed on the next Board of Supervisors meeting agenda.
Mr. Rogers said
that asked Chief Coluzzi if he could provide the Board with a number of how
many people in the Township are disabled.
Mr. Rogers said Chief Coluzzi was very receptive to giving the Board
that information and would provide the number of people he has from his records
and the Neighborhood Watch Groups as soon as he could.
Mr. Fegley
suggested having a section on the Board’s web-site asking people if they need
information about services for people with disabilities. Ms. Piccinotti suggested reaching out to the
seniors in the area also.
Mr. Rogers
discussed possible invitees for future meetings. He suggested inviting the Fire Marshall to
discuss evacuation procedures for disabled school students, Jeff Werner of the
Yardley News and a member of the Bensalem Disabled Persons Advisory Board to
get ideas on how to get their group started.
He would extend and invitation to attend the September meeting.
